“BOXTED, a parish in the Colchester division of the hundred of LEXDEN, county of ESSEX, 5 miles (N.) from Colchester, containing 793 inhabitants. The living is a discharged vicarage, in the archdeaconry of Colchester, and diocese of London, rated in the king's books at £7. 13. 9., endowed with £200 private benefaction, and £200 royal bounty, and in the patronage of the Bishop of London. The church is dedicated to St. Mary. The navigable river Stour runs on the northern side of this parish.” [From Samuel Lewis A Topographical Dictionary of England (1831) - copyright Mel Lockie 2016]
